What Is Sequential Searching In Data Structure?

by | Last updated on January 24, 2024

, , , ,

The sequential search (sometimes called a linear search) is

the simplest type of search

, it is used when a list of integers is not in any order. It examines the first element in the list and then examines each “sequential” element in the list until a match is found.

What is sequential search algorithm in data structure?

Sequential Search is

the most natural searching method

. In this method, the searching begins with searching every element of the list till the required record is found. It makes no demands on the ordering of records. It takes considerably amount of time and is slower.

What is meant by sequential search?

In computer science, a linear search or sequential search is

a method for finding an element within a list

. It sequentially checks each element of the list until a match is found or the whole list has been searched.

What is a sequential search in database?

When searching the data records, the database system can always perform a sequential search (table scan) – that is,

search through the whole table row for row

. The sequential search (table scan) is the simplest search strategy of the SQL Optimizer.

What is sequential search and binary search?

The two algorithms we are looking at in this unit, sequential search and binary search, take different amounts of time to complete a search, and sequential search is less efficient than binary search. … Binary search on the other hand is more predictable and is guaranteed to work within a small number of steps.

What is an example of sequential search?

One of the most straightforward and elementary searches is the sequential search, also known as a linear search. As a real world example,

pickup the nearest phonebook and open it to the first page of names

. … Keep looking at the next name until you find “Smith”.

How do you use sequential search?

The sequential search (sometimes called a linear search) is the simplest type of search, it is used

when a list of integers is not in any order

. It examines the first element in the list and then examines each “sequential” element in the list until a match is found.

Which sorting algorithm is best?

Algorithm Best Worst
Bubble Sort

Ω(n) O(n^2)
Merge Sort Ω(n log(n)) O(n log(n)) Insertion Sort Ω(n) O(n^2) Selection Sort Ω(n^2) O(n^2)

How does a sequential algorithm work?

In computer science, a sequential algorithm or serial algorithm is an algorithm that

is executed sequentially – once through, from start to finish, without other processing executing

– as opposed to concurrently or in parallel.

Which is the best definition for algorithm?

An algorithm (pronounced AL-go-rith-um) is

a procedure or formula for solving a problem, based on conducting a sequence of specified actions

. A computer program can be viewed as an elaborate algorithm. In mathematics and computer science, an algorithm usually means a small procedure that solves a recurrent problem.

What is sequential search in C?

A linear search, also known as a sequential search, is

a method of finding an element within a list

. It checks each element of the list sequentially until a match is found or the whole list has been searched.

Can a sequential list be searched?

Each data item is stored in a position relative to the others. In Python lists, these relative positions are the index values of the individual items. Since these index values are ordered, it is possible for us to visit them in sequence. This process gives rise to our first searching technique, the sequential search.

What is required to implement a sequential search?

Note that sequential searches don’t require that the data be sorted. Next, we will need a method that performs the sequential search. This method accepts two parameters: 1) the name of the array and 2) the key value we are searching for. If the value is not found, the

function returns

-1.

What is difference between Sequential and binary search?

Sequential Search Binary Search Finds the key present at first position in constant time Finds the key present at center position in constant time

Which is the fastest searching algorithm?

According to a simulation conducted by researchers, it is known that

Binary search

is commonly the fastest searching algorithm. A binary search is performed for the ordered list. This idea makes everything make sense that we can compare each element in a list systematically.

What are different searching techniques?

There are numerous searching algorithms in a data structure such as

linear search, binary search, interpolation search, sublist search, exponential search, jump search, Fibonacci search

, the ubiquitous binary search, recursive function for substring search, unbounded, binary search, and recursive program to search an …

Emily Lee
Author
Emily Lee
Emily Lee is a freelance writer and artist based in New York City. She’s an accomplished writer with a deep passion for the arts, and brings a unique perspective to the world of entertainment. Emily has written about art, entertainment, and pop culture.